Big & Green
I gave my Acura MDX to my daughter and was looking for another solid SUV. Fell in love with the MB GL450 at first sight. Beautiful inside and out. Then saw the 320CDI version and drove it. Couldn't believe it was a diesel. Who would believe that you could have large comfortably luxury in an SUV and get 27 mpg on the highway? I was only worried about recent MB quality surveys on Consumer Reports but felt a little better given that the GL was totally redesigned.

A Superior SUV
I wanted to move out of my less than dependable Volvo XC90 into a larger vehicle with better mileage. I looked at everything and eventually bought the diesel GL320 for the following reasons: Exceptional mileage for such a large vehicle. The performance of the diesel engine is superior to that of the twin turbocharged gas engine in the XC90, as well as some of the larger V8's. Extremely quiet and comfortable ride. The standard air suspension is perfect. Initial impression is that it is as solid as a bank vault. Crossing my fingers that the recent Mercedes quality problems do not crop up.
